As per the Office of the Secretary to the Governor General of Canada, Canada does not use a hyphen for "Governor General".
The Right Honourable Jeanne Sauvé, P.C., C.C., C.M.M., C.D., the 23rd Governor General of Canada, was the first female to serve as Canada's governor general.
Address the Governor General or his or her spouse as "Excellency" or "Your Excellency" first, then as "Sir" or "Madame" as is gender appropriate thereafter.
The Governor General of Canada earns CAD $129,800 per annum.
